CURATORIAL & CULTURAL PROJECTS

Through performances, salons, and interdisciplinary collaborations, Qiao Chen develops site-responsive cultural experiences that bring together music, architecture, visual arts, literature, and conversation. Her curatorial practice reimagines classical music as a contemporary social and aesthetic experience, creating intimate encounters between artists, audiences, and space.
